The Confederate Fighter motorcycle joins the BMW 7 Series motorcycle models for 2009. These machines are of course limited edition bikes - there would be just 45 Confederate Fighter motorcycles in the world.
The Confederate Fighter uses a girder-style front suspension made up of titanium, aluminum and carbon fiber bits and a 120ci 45-degree air-cooled V-Twin.
The usual carbon fiber monocoque chassis is substituted for a backbone unit made from titanium connected to front and rear bulkheads cut from solid chunks of billet aluminum.
Top speed is expected to be 190 miles per hour. And how much would it cost? Not much, just $110,000.
